If you require alternate transportation, Kansas City has several choices for getting around the city. Uber, Lyft and Z-trip (cabs) - These are smart phone app based scheduling options. Rides can be requested using their smart phone apps that are downloaded from your phones app store. City Buses - The Airbnb is located on the city bus route and can be accessed from more than 5 bus stop within a 3 block radius of the rental. These give access to all routes throughout the city. Bus runs 7 days a week but frequency and schedules vary. Generally they are available Mon-Fri, 5 am to midnight and Sat-Sun, 9 am to 2 am but should be verified on the RIDEKC website. Streetcar - The Kansas City Street car is free and runs every 15 minutes between Crown Center and the River Market. The details can be found on the RideKC website. Ride share bikes - Public bike rental stations are available throughout the city. Information found at the KCbcycle website. Ride share scooters - For shorter distances or a fun way of sight seeing in the city; two ride share scooter options are available: Lime and Bird . To quickly get started and get further details, search for Bird or Lime apps on your smart phone in your providers app store. 1109 KingBd *Garage*Disabled Frndly

Great space for family or business travel, includes garage. Close to Legends shopping, I70 and I435 highways. We say disability friendly because it is a new build with wide doorways and a no barrier entrance from the garage. We have lowered the digital garage door keypad to wheelchair height. The largest bathroom has front loader laundry, a roll up sink and a no barrier shower with grab bars and an adjustable shower head. Trash carts are on the North side of the building.
